noun
  1. A specific form or variation of something.
  2. A translation from one language to another.
It's in the King James Version only.
  1. An account or description from a particular point of view, especially as contrasted with another account
He gave another of the affair.
  1. (computing): A number indicating which revision something is. (Software, firmware, CPUs, etc.)
  2. (medicine): A condition of the uterus in which its axis is deflected from its normal position without being bent upon itself. See anteversion, and retroversion.
Translations: Etymology: From (term, , French, version), from versioLatin, versiÅ (a turning), from vertere (to turn). Used in English since 16th century.
